Output e18500aeed1066ac0fec541bae6971bba44bb3b446045a123e5ee0a94aabcbf8:0

value
23698360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3276f370fa9da0bc18ac7819be19ac283b1dcb OP_EQUAL
address
3FvunpDEhr5HsRUpHTF62FMZjA3R69kvzq
transaction
e18500aeed1066ac0fec541bae6971bba44bb3b446045a123e5ee0a94aabcbf8
spent
true